  2. Miami Design District -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Miami_Design_District

    Design District. /  25.81278°N 80.19222°W  / 25.81278; -80.19222. The Miami Design District is a neighborhood in Miami, Florida, United States, and a shopping, dining and cultural destination—home to over 130 art galleries, showrooms, creative services, architecture firms, luxury fashion stores, antiques dealers, eateries and bars.
